Step into the vibrant world of California Institute of the Arts (CalArts), a trailblazing institution born from Walt Disney's vision to revolutionize arts education. Founded in 1961 through the merger of the esteemed Chouinard Art Institute and the Los Angeles Conservatory of Music, CalArts was conceived as a destination for artistic talent, a feeder school for the burgeoning arts industries that Disney himself knew so well. It quickly became a haven for counterculture and avant-garde artists, shaping a unique educational philosophy that continues to thrive today.

CalArts is globally renowned for its innovative and interdisciplinary approach to the arts. While initially formed to address financial difficulties of its predecessors, the institute grew to establish iconic programs like Character Animation and Jazz, attracting students who seek to push creative boundaries. Its history is marked by resilience, from overcoming financial instability in its early years to navigating the challenges of the 1994 Northridge Earthquake, which saw classes temporarily held in tents. This spirit of adaptability underscores a student experience that is both rigorous and deeply experimental.

Under the leadership of presidents like Robert J. Fitzpatrick and Steven D. Lavine, CalArts solidified its reputation, expanding enrollment and developing cutting-edge programs. Today, under President Ravi Rajan, the institute continues to foster an environment of artistic exploration, evident in its experimental interdisciplinary laboratories such as the CHANEL Center for Artists and Technology and the Cotsen Center for Puppetry. Timeline

1883
Los Angeles Conservatory of Music founded
1921
Chouinard Art Institute founded
1961
California Institute of the Arts (CalArts) formed by merger
1965
CalArts Alumni Association founded
1971
CalArts moved to its current Valencia campus
1975
Robert J. Fitzpatrick appointed president, establishing Character Animation and Jazz programs
1994
Northridge Earthquake closed main building, classes held in temporary tents
2003
Roy & Edna Disney CalArts Theatre added to operations
2017
Ravi S. Rajan appointed president
